Planning application
Bush Babies Children's Centre and Day Nursery 1 Tudor Close and 42 Warwick Road Sutton Coldfield Birmingham B73 6SX
Works: Extension
Permission granted.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ses.
Proposal
Change of use of existing Day centre (Use Class E) to form extension to existing Nursery (Use class E), with ancillary alterations to create additional parking
As published by the council, reference 2024/05781/PA

About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
